LCR West Hartford Designer Bios: Peter Robbin

LCR West Hartford, Connecticut is an interior design firm and retail shop owned by lead interior designer Peter Robbin. Peter has a Bachelors of Fine Arts and a Bachelors of Interior Architecture, both from Rhode Island School of Design. After he graduated, Peter worked in Paris for 6 months before heading to New York City. There, he gained experience working for three well-known interior firms. Then, in 1987, Peter moved to Connecticut and purchased what is now LCR from interior designer John LaFalce.

Peter’s design philosophy is based in tradition. As a classically trained interior designer, he enjoys designing a room in a classic/eclectic mix, working to incorporate classic pieces ranging from Traditional to 20th Century Modern, to Asian to French. In a classic/eclectic mix Peter feels that because of the juxtaposition of the different styles, their best features are then highlighted; the curved leg of a Louis XV chair is highlighted and more visually appealing when it’s against a hard line of an Asian end table. Then, Peter uses proportion, materials and color to tie everything together and give the room a cohesive look. Texture is also a tool Peter uses in his interiors, using it to give the room a warm and friendly feel. When different textures are found throughout a room it feels more comfortable and inviting- the room says come touch, not look and don’t touch.

For Peter it is important to get to know his client before starting to scheme for his design. He observes how the client dresses and presents him or herself and uses that information to design a room that best suits their personality and style. He also takes time to find out how the room will be used and how it is naturally lit; two important factors in his design.

Peter Robbin is a designer who’s interiors are based in tradition but always stylish. He turns away from current trends in favor of a design that is timeless and will never go out of style, using classics from an array of periods to give a room a cohesive and beautiful design, only adding new style that will become tomorrow’s classic. There is so much currently stylish that is dated in a few short years.

Peter’s designs have been featured in publications such as Colonial Homes Magazine, Metropolitan Home Magazine, House Beautiful, and Hartford Magazine.
